※ 引述《asxu31 (xu3)》之銘言:
: 想請問一下,目前知道二極體不會通,但為什麼輸出是-2.5~2.5?
: 就算二極體沒導通,在正半週的時間裡,電容也不會充電嗎?
: 謝謝
: https://i.imgur.com/LafNIlo.jpg
這題在考電容特性,電容跨壓不會"瞬間"改變。
但是電容的兩端各自的"電位"是會瞬間改變的
這題的Vo在穩態時都為0V(無論Vi=0或2.5V),
電容在穩態時的跨壓為2.5V(Vi=2.5V)或0V(Vi=0V)
所以在Vi瞬間改變時,Vo會有+-2.5V的彈跳。
若更仔細把式子列出來,如下
把時間分為三個階段來分析
(i) 0~0.5T Vi此時為0V, 假設Vc(0-)=0V
(ii)0.5T~T Vi此時為2.5V
(iii)T~1.5T Vi此時為0V
(i)
Vi=0V, Vo=0V,
穩態時Vc(0.5T-)=0V
(ii)
Vi(0.5T+)=2.5V,
因為Vc(0.5T-)=Vc(0.5T+)=0V
Vo(0.5T+)=Vi(0.5T+)-Vc(0.5T+)=2.5V-0V=2.5V (Vo最高點)
當穩態時,電容開路,路徑上沒有電流,Vo(T-)=0V
Vc(T-)=Vi(T-)-Vo(T-)=2.5V-0V=2.5V
(iii)
Vi(T+)=0V,
因為Vc(T-)=Vc(T+)=2.5V
Vo(T+)=Vi(T+)-Vc(T+)=0V-2.5V=-2.5V (Vo最低點)
當穩態時,電容開路,Vo(1.5T-)=0V
Vc(1.5T-)=Vi(1.5T-)-Vo(T-)=0V-0V=0V
但其實這題出題有瑕疵,
方波頻率1kHz,周期1ms,電容充放電時間為周期一半只有0.5ms
R=10kohm, C=10uF, time constant = RC = 100ms
也就是說一半的周期0.5ms根本不足夠讓電容充電到穩態
(充放電時間至少也要3個time constant)
以至於方波瞬間轉變電壓的時候(0->2.5V或2.5V->0V)
電容前一個狀態的電壓也不會達到2.5V或0V,
進而導致Vo也不會有peak電壓達到+-2.5V(peak彈跳之值會小2.5V)